But you need hood pins . Cause people that onw compact cars and that are dumb . get this hoods and don't use hood pins . then that hood smashes the windsheald and the sunroof ( if they have one ) cause it folds over the car like that . And that's from the latch coming off the hood ( basicly vibration will crack that thin fiberglass that glued to the steel ) .
